Our verdict is Uncertain significance. The variant received 1 ACMG points: 2P and 1B. PM2BP4

The NM_017649.5(CNNM2):​c.115G>C​(p.Gly39Arg)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000212 in 1,413,282 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 13/22 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another nucleotide change resulting in the same amino acid substitution has been previously reported as Uncertain significance in ClinVar.

CNNM2 (HGNC:103): (cyclin and CBS domain divalent metal cation transport mediator 2) This gene encodes a member of the ancient conserved domain containing protein family. Members of this protein family contain a cyclin box motif and have structural similarity to the cyclins. The encoded protein may play an important role in magnesium homeostasis by mediating the epithelial transport and renal reabsorption of Mg2+. Mutations in this gene are associated with renal hypomagnesemia. Alternatively spliced transcript variants encoding multiple isoforms have been observed for this gene. [provided by RefSeq, Dec 2011]
